Subcommittee on the Constitution, Civil Rights and Human Rights
Majority Members: 6 Total Members: 11
Minority Members: 5
Members:
Durbin, Richard J. (IL), Chairman
Leahy, Patrick J. (VT)
Whitehouse, Sheldon (RI)
Franken, Al (MN)
Coons, Christopher A. (DE)
Blumenthal, Richard (CT)
Graham, Lindsey (SC), Ranking Member
Kyl, Jon (AZ)
Cornyn, John (TX)
Lee, Mike (UT)
Coburn, Tom (OK)
